Despite Twitter rumblings, three-time Rock & Roll Jeopardy! champion/Sugar Ray singer Mark McGrath is very much alive. He addressed recent rumors of his death via Twitter and, as many suspected, it was all a big hoax.
Final word on the death hoax thing, I knew nothing about it and found out the same time you did…sorry about any confusion
— mark mcgrath (@mark_mcgrath) February 26, 2015
He even apologizes for a death rumor someone else started. What a gentleman!

According to Huffington Post, that “someone” may have been working to promote the Adult Swim show Hot Package, which features McGrath.
Here’s what we do know: This morning (Feb. 26), a creative consultancy company called Prismatics sent out a press release claiming the Sugar Ray frontman had been killed, sparking an online rumor. It read:
Musician Mark McGrath has died at the age of 46. McGrath was on set filming the second season of entertainment show Hot Package, when he was confronted by a masked gunman and shot several times. The former Sugar Ray frontman died in the arms of his co-host Derrick Beckles on the Hollywood set of the show.
In honor of Mr. McGrath’s legacy, his team is asking in liu [sic] of flowers, fans post a Sugar Ray Selfie, holding a packet of sugar over their heart. #RIPMARKMCGRATH

Once the rumors picked up, Prismatics sent out this message to clear up the controversy they started hours prior:
Tomorrow night on the Season 2 Premiere of Hot Package, Mark McGrath is killed by a masked gunman and dies in the arms of his co-host Derrick Beckles.
It’s important to note that Mark McGrath is alive and well in real life.
The Season 2 premiere of Hot Package airs tomorrow at 12:30 AM on Adult Swim.
#RIPMARKMCGRATH
However, a statement from an Adult Swim spokesperson (via TBS) denies the channel’s involvement entirely: “This press release did not come from Adult Swim and is not part of any network PR or marketing campaign for the show Hot Package.”
USA Today reported that TBS (which owns Adult Swim) denies hiring Prismatics to do publicity for Hot Package, and had no knowledge of the hoax until it hit.
At any rate, mission accomplished — a lot more people have heard about Hot Package. Its second season premieres tomorrow at 12:30 a.m. (ET).
And McGrath, 46 years young, will continue to live, breathe, eat, act, and perform with Sugar Ray. The band has three upcoming shows, including Hershey, Penn.’s Mixtape Festival, alongside acts like New Kids on the Block and TLC.
